1. Classic ’90s Layered Bob

This is basically what you’ll get if you ask for a classic ’90s layered bob. As the name suggests, this bob features layers that add movement and texture. Even though you’ll be cutting off some length, you won’t lose your volume. It’s a stylish, feminine, and low-maintenance haircut you need to try!
